Matic Dimic holds a clear edge in this ITF M25 Maribor clay-court matchup due to greater professional experience and a stronger recent ITF record compared to Alex Ganchev. The 24-year-old Slovenian, ranked near 2200-2260, maintains a career win rate above 50 percent across 200-plus matches, with solid clay results in home events and consistent qualification success. Ganchev, a Bulgarian transitioning from U.S. college tennis, carries a lower-ranked profile and a 2026 record showing more losses than wins in M15/M25 events, including early exits on clay. Both players favor baseline rallies on the surface, but Dimic’s deeper match history and familiarity with Slovenian conditions represent the primary drivers of current market positioning ahead of the August 24 encounter.

This market will resolve to 'Matic Dimic' if Matic Dimic advances against Alex Ganchev.
This market will resolve to 'Alex Ganchev' if Alex Ganchev advances against Matic Dimic.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or a winner has not been determined by September 7, 2026, 11:59 PM ET (14 days after the scheduled start), this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the International Tennis Federation (ITF). A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
